One dimensional Array
Write C++ program to do the following:
1. Declare an array of size 7 integer numbers
2. Read 7 integers from the user, and save them in the array.
3. Print the following in a file "output.txt":
a) Elements of the array
b) Odd integers in the array
c) Even integers in the array
d) Minimum elements
e) Maximum element.
Sample input/ output
Enter 7 Integers: 10 21 3 45 5 36 23
File "output.txt "
Element in the arrays are: 10 21 3 455 36 23
Odd Numbers: 21 3 45 5 23
Even Numbers: 10 36
Minimum: 3
Maximum: 45
